Akbar (1556-1605 AD) - silver ½ rupee, mintless and dateless type, similar to KM 91.1 but fraction, 5.30g. Obv: Allahu Akbar. Rev: Jal Jalalahu, variety with letter Jim of 'Jal' extended into a long stroke, floral decorative fields on both sides.

Very fine, Extremely rare.

The type was introduced by Akbar soon after AH 990, to herald the 'timeless' Islamic Millenium, in which he would be the 'Khalifah' or supreme leader. On a practical level, it helped counter the discounting of older coins by shroffs who relied on the date mentioned on the coin to apply it. Fractional issues of this type are exceedingly rare.
